【如何搭建服务器】搭建服务器是一个涉及硬件配置、软件安装和网络设置的综合过程。对于初学者来说,了解基本步骤和所需工具非常重要。以下是对“如何搭建服务器”这一问题的总结性说明,并以表格形式展示关键信息。
一、搭建服务器的基本流程
1. 明确需求
根据用途(如网站、游戏、文件存储等)确定服务器类型和性能要求。
2. 选择服务器类型
包括物理服务器、虚拟服务器或云服务器,根据预算和需求进行选择。
3. 准备硬件或云资源
如果是物理服务器,需购买主板、CPU、内存、硬盘等;如果是云服务器,则在服务商平台创建实例。
4. 安装操作系统
常见系统有Windows Server、Linux(如Ubuntu、CentOS)、FreeBSD等。
5. 配置网络环境
设置IP地址、DNS、防火墙规则等,确保服务器能正常访问互联网。
6. 安装必要服务
如Web服务器(Apache/Nginx)、数据库(MySQL/PostgreSQL)、邮件服务器等。
7. 安全加固
安装杀毒软件、配置SSH密钥登录、定期更新系统补丁等。
8. 测试与维护
验证服务器是否正常运行,建立日常监控和备份机制。
二、关键信息表格
步骤 | 内容说明 | 工具/技术 | 注意事项 |
1 | 明确服务器用途 | 无 | 需提前规划功能需求 |
2 | 选择服务器类型 | 物理服务器 / 虚拟服务器 / 云服务器 | 根据预算和性能需求决定 |
3 | 准备硬件或云资源 | 硬件组件 / 云平台(如阿里云、AWS) | 确保硬件兼容性和云配置合理 |
4 | 安装操作系统 | Windows Server / Linux(Ubuntu/CentOS) | 选择适合业务系统的版本 |
5 | 配置网络环境 | IP地址、DNS、防火墙 | 确保网络连通性和安全性 |
6 | 安装必要服务 | Apache/Nginx、MySQL、PHP等 | 根据应用需求安装对应组件 |
7 | 安全加固 | SSH密钥、防火墙规则、杀毒软件 | 避免未授权访问和漏洞攻击 |
8 | 测试与维护 | 监控工具(如Zabbix)、备份策略 | 定期检查日志和更新系统 |
三、总结
搭建服务器虽然涉及多个步骤,但只要按照逻辑顺序逐步操作,就可以顺利完成。无论是物理服务器还是云服务器,都需要从需求分析开始,合理配置软硬件,并注重安全和维护。通过表格的形式可以更清晰地理解每个环节的关键内容和注意事项,帮助用户避免常见错误,提高搭建效率。
建议初学者从简单的虚拟机或云服务器入手,熟悉后再尝试搭建物理服务器。同时,不断学习相关知识,有助于提升服务器管理能力。